1) Research Job Market

Most of the local employers advertise on different job sites. It is not very tough to know the job market trends in your particular sector. By researching on various sites, you can say quickly who is hiring and skills related to your sector on different high demands. By researching, you can easily know how quickly you find a good employer. You can easily do it by checking out their websites (researching on the employer). There are some popular job websites, where you can easily find a decent job in different sectors from junior level to senior level. You can easily find the job by researching on job markets according to your ability.

4) Set Your Daily Routine

It is very important for you that you should keep regularly applying for the month before coming to Dubai. Because many employers take a time to review an application and your time is limited. After going to Dubai do not forget to update your contact information and your CV on an online public profile. It is vital for employers or job finders to keep applying for jobs and also updating their CV at online public profiles on a daily basis. It is essential how many times you refresh your CV and update your contact information. Always try to update your CV to make sure that your CV is on top of search results.

6) Prepare For Your Job Interview

Ask in your network what type of questions you expect to be asked, practice your answer. Remember, Interviews just about your first impression. Do not be confused. Grooming and physical appearance are also very important. There is no chance for the first impression. So your physical appearance is also imperative for the first impression.

7) Smarten Up Your Online Presence

Recruiters and just about anyone can find you easily these days. Clean up your photo whether on Facebook or any other web. Your email address also is one designated for your job. Employers will Google you, so get rid of those photos and blog entries.
